How wet-mounted pumps work
Wet-mounted pumps are specifically designed for pumping liquids from deep or hard-to-reach areas. They consist of a motor mounted outside the liquid and a vertical shaft that drives the impeller in the medium. This construction enables reliable pumping even at high delivery heights and under difficult conditions.
The medium is sucked in by the impeller and transported upward along the vertical axis. Thanks to the positioning of the motor, it remains dry and protected from contact with aggressive or corrosive liquids, which increases the pump’s lifespan and ease of maintenance. Vertical pumps are therefore particularly suitable for applications with high demands on reliability and performance, such as in sewage treatment plants, the chemical industry, and mining.

The selection of the right pump depends on several factors that must be tailored to the specific requirements of your application:
- Flow rate and delivery head: Determine how much liquid should be pumped per hour and what delivery head is required. These factors directly affect the performance of the pump.
- Type of medium to be pumped: Check the properties of the medium to be pumped, such as viscosity, temperature, and chemical composition. Pay attention to the chemical resistance of the pump, especially if aggressive media are involved.
- Material resistance: Pay attention to the correct material. Our submersible pumps are made of chemically resistant materials such as PP, PVDF, or stainless steel, making them ideal for aggressive media.
